Deprecating the DHE cipher suite for TLS connections
Vercel will deprecate the DHE-RSA-AES256-GCM-SHA384 cipher suite for TLS 1.2 connections on June 30, 2026, leaving six ECDHE-based suites supported; TLS 1.3 clients are unaffected.
On June 30th, 2026, Vercel will remove support for the legacy cipher suite.DHE-RSA-AES256-GCM-SHA384 This cipher may still be used by automated systems, security scanners, and HTTP clients with non-standard TLS configurations. After this date, clients using TLS 1.2 will only be able to connect to the Vercel network with :our six remaining cipher suites Modern clients and TLS 1.3 connections are unaffected. If you operate integrations or automated systems that connect to a domain hosted on Vercel over TLS 1.2, verify that your TLS client supports at least one of the above cipher suites.
